Kanye West’s Producer Mike Dean Quits, Calls ‘DONDA’ Process ‘Toxic’
Mike Dean Goes Back Home After Toxic Kanye West’s ‘DONDA’ Production Process
Couple of weeks back, Kanye West announced that his new album Donda was just days away from release following his album listening party at the Mercedes Benz Stadium in Atlanta.
But ever since, Kanye’s been spiraling out of control – and so has his project Donda. And by the look of things now, it may never come out.
The rap and business mogul moved into the stadium and vowed not to leave until the album was finished. He also said he’s going to be producing the project all on his own, going forward.
View this post on Instagram
According to reports, Kanye’s longtime collaborator and Donda producer, prolific Hip Hop producer Mike Dean, has quit the project.
Last night Mike tweeted and deleted, “F- This!’ and then selected everything Donda related from his Instagram account. He then liked a post from a follower who called Kanye’s process ‘toxic’ and later Tweeted, “It’s good to be at the house.”
